Synopsis:

Thoroughly revised and updated, the 4th Edition of this groundbreaking text traces the historical development of the foundations of modern occupational therapy theory; examines its status today; and, looks to its future. Dr. Kielhofner compares and contrasts eight well-known models, using diagrams to illustrate their practical applications and to highlight their similarities and differences. Well organized chapters are supported by extensive references. This title offers the most comprehensive coverage of theories in the field. It presents a framework for understanding what kind of knowledge is needed to support practice and critically examines existing knowledge. It provides a structure for thinking about and analyzing knowledge in order to compare different approaches. It includes summary tables for each model. It highlights profession-wide concepts such as dynamic systems, narrative, and occupational form.
